Happy Hunting follows Warren, an alcoholic drifter, who stumbles into a desert town where the locals hunt down “undesirables” for sport. As he becomes the next target, Warren must rely on his survival instincts and combat skills to outsmart the hunters and escape the brutal game.

Most significantly, Warren and Steve are alike due totheir relationship with fatherhood.

Before the kidnapping, Warren and Steve have a heart-to-heart where Steve discloses he caused Cheryl to miscarry.

Both men aretrapped on the cusp of fatherhood.

Happy Hunting

The empty bedroom and unanswered phone serve as symbols of what Steve and Warren are reaching for.

Through their own actions, Steve and Warren have deprived themselves of being fathers.

The entire plot is only precipitated once Warren learns he has a daughter.

He has no experience of being a parent.

When the audience meets Warren, he is drunk and cooking meth.

Staples like 2007sThe Mist,1989sPet Sematary, or even 1977sEraserheadare all about fathers attempting to do right by their children.

He doesnt want to live for himself, rather he wants to live to meet his child.

Warren is technically a parent, but he wants to get the chancetoparent.

Robbie is ultimately killed in front of Warren by the Wakowski siblings, a trio of hunters.

Some feel the ending ofHappy Huntingis an unnecessary sucker punch, a beat of needless edginess.

Yet, it seems intentional thatHappy Huntingnever depicts a father/child relationship.

Steve is haunted by the pregnancy he accidentally ended.

Warren watches the teenager he tries to take care of bleed out.

He never gets to see his daughter.
